About this ebook

Mobile Home Living explores the growing trend of portable housing, examining its unique architecture and societal impact. It addresses the increasing interest in alternative living arrangements, such as minimalist living and eco-friendly designs. The book highlights how mobile homes challenge traditional notions of home, offering flexibility and affordability.

Discover how mobile living connects to social science through sociological surveys and interviews. The book delves into the historical roots of mobile homes, from early trailers to modern, technologically advanced designs. It analyzes social and economic factors driving the adoption of nomadic lifestyles, including financial constraints and the pursuit of location-independent living.

The text progresses from introducing the concept and its history, to showcasing architectural innovations and sustainable materials, and finally examining the social impact of mobile living and its challenges. This book adopts a balanced approach, presenting both the advantages and disadvantages of mobile living while avoiding excessive jargon.

By incorporating case studies and real-world examples, the book provides valuable insights for architects, urban planners, sociologists, and individuals considering mobile housing options. It acknowledges the complexities of mobile living, offering a comprehensive overview of its impact on individuals and society.
